    FEDERAL MARITIME COMMISSION
    
    [Docket No. 94-20]
    
     
    
    Cancellation of Tariffs for Failure To Comply With Automated 
    Tariff Filing and Information System (``ATFI'') Filing Requirements; 
    Order To Show Cause
    
        Section 8 of the Shipping Act of 1984 (``1984 Act''), 46 U.S.C. 
    app. 1707, and section 18(a) of the Shipping Act, 1916, (``1916 Act''), 
    46 U.S.C. app. 817, and section 2 of the Intercoastal Shipping Act of 
    1933 (``1933 Act''), 46 U.S.C. app. 844, require common carriers in the 
    United States foreign commerce and domestic offshore commerce, 
    respectively, to file tariffs with the Commission. The 1984 Act also 
    directs carriers and conferences that offer service contracts to 
    publish the essential terms of those contracts in an ETP. Marine 
    terminal operators operating in both the foreign and/or domestic 
    offshore commerce of the United States are required by Commission 
    regulations to file tariffs with the Commission. (46 CFR part 514)
        Section 17 of the 1984 Act, 46 U.S.C. app. 1716, section 43 of the 
    1916, 46 U.S.C. 841a, and section 2 of the 1933 Act empower the 
    Commission to prescribe rules and regulations necessary to carry out 
    the provisions of the corresponding statutes. Pursuant to this 
    authority, the Commission instituted Docket No. 90-23, Automated Tariff 
    Filing and Information System (``ATFI''), to establish regulations 
    governing the conversion of tariff filing to an electronic system. 
    Proposed Rules were issued on September 9, 1991 (56 FR 46,044) and 
    Interim Rules were issued on August 12, 1992 (57 FR 36,248) and January 
    4, 1993 (58 FR 25). The rules issued in Docket No. 90-23 are codified 
    in 46 CFR part 514. This new part modifies and combines all non-
    obsolete tariff regulations of 46 CFR parts 515, 550, 580 and 581, and 
    establishes regulations to facilitate and implement the conversion of 
    tariffs to ATFI.\1\
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
    
        \1\Section 502(b)(1) of Pub. L. No. 102-582 requires all tariffs 
    and essential terms of service contracts to be filed electronically 
    with the Commission. 106 Stat. 4900, 4910-11.
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
    
        On December 17, 1992, the Commission issued Supplemental Report No. 
    3 and Notice (``Supplemental Report No. 3'') (57 FR 59,999) in Docket 
    No. 90-23. Supplemental Report No. 3 prescribed the schedule by which 
    entities serving specific trades must convert tariff data into ATFI, 
    and defined the geographic areas subject to each ATFI filing time frame 
    (``window''). It also provided that tariffs which are not filed in ATFI 
    by the close of the applicable filing window are subject to 
    cancellation by order of the Commission in a show-cause proceeding, 
    unless temporarily exempted.
        In January, 1993, the Commission's Bureau of Tariffs, Certification 
    and Licensing (``BTCL'') mailed Information Bulletin No. IB 4-93 to 
    over 4,000 firms. This Bulletin included the schedule of filing windows 
    and a statement regarding cancellation of unconverted tariffs by show-
    cause order. Supplemental Report No. 4 in Docket No. 90-23, issued in 
    June, 1993, again advised the public of the filing schedule and that 
    failure to file in ATFI would subject entities to a proceeding for the 
    cancellation of tariffs.
        The Commission has issued three show cause orders cancelling the 
    tariffs or portions thereof of carriers that failed to register and 
    file in an electronic format by the required date.\2\ The 243 carriers 
    listed on the Attachment to this Order represent those carriers and 
    conferences that have not filed their ATFI tariffs for the remaining 
    filing windows, i.e., European,\3\ African/Mid Eastern, North American/
    Caribbean, Central/South American, and the domestic-offshore trades. 
    Also included are marine terminal operators and carriers with essential 
    terms publications on file with the Commission that have failed to file 
    their marine terminal tariffs in the ATFI system, failed to file an 
    ATFI essential terms publication or failed to cancel its paper ETP.\4\ 
    Also included are approximately 20 carriers whose rate tariffs have 
    been cancelled for various reasons but whose ETP's remain on file.
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
    
        \2\Docket No. 93-19--Cancellation of Tariffs for Failure to 
    Comply with Automated Tariff Filing and Information System 
    (``ATFI'') Filing Requirements. By order issued January 12, 1994 (59 
    FR 1737), the paper tariffs or portions thereof of 67 carriers were 
    cancelled for failure to register and file; Docket No. 93-25, 
    Cancellation of Tariffs for Failure to Comply with Automated Tariff 
    Filing and Information System (``ATFI'') Filing Requirements 
    (European Trade). By order issued May 5, 1994 (59 FR 24430), the 
    paper tariffs or portions thereof of 19 carriers were cancelled for 
    failure to register and file; and Docket No. 94-04--Cancellation of 
    Tariffs for Failure to Comply with Automated Tariff Filing and 
    Information System (``ATFI'') Filing Requirements. By order issued 
    July 29, 1994 (59 FR 38605), the tariffs or portion thereof of 37 
    carriers were cancelled for failure to file.
        \3\The order issued in Docket No. 93-25 included only those 
    persons in the European Trade that did not register and file by the 
    required date. The Order to Show Cause issued this date includes 
    those carriers that have registered in ATFI but have failed to file 
    a tariff in electronic format.
        \4\Certain carriers have paper ETP's on file with the Commission 
    as well as an effective ATFI filed ETP. These paper ETP's are being 
    made the subject of this show cause proceeding except to the extent 
    that they continue to have application with respect to essential 
    terms and service contracts that were filed prior to ATFI's 
    implementation. The Commission is not allowing new essential terms 
    and service contracts to be filed in paper format. Accordingly, 
    paper ETP's, not having been voluntarily cancelled by the carriers 
    on even a limited basis must now be cancelled by the Commission.
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
    
        Now therefore, it is ordered that pursuant to section 11 of the 
    1984 Act, 46 U.S.C. 1710, the entities listed in the Attachment to this 
    Order are directed to show cause, within 45 days after the publication 
    of this Order in the Federal Register, why the Commission should not 
    cancel their tariffs for failure to conform to the requirements of 
    section 8 of the 1984 Act, 46 CFR part 514, and Supplemental Reports 
    Nos. 2, 3, and 4 issued in Docket No. 90-23;
        It is further ordered, that a copy of this Order be sent by 
    certified mail to the last known address of the entities listed in the 
    Attachment;
        It is further ordered, that this order be published in the Federal 
    Register.
